I know this is old, but I enjoyed reading it, and wanted to chime in...
Man, what an incident to have to deal with. I think that there were some very good things done here, especially in building the case to take to the police. Very good job there.
As far as when things started getting physical, I'm not sure how I would have dealt with that. Especially when it comes to getting hit and kicked. Some kind of restraint would have been in order, and it was good that he had a friend to help him out there.
Something that really bugs me here is that the driver didn't do anything to take control of the situation. It is not something that he should do while driving, but the driver should have done something. Stop the bus, radio his dispatch, or do something to get that troublesome kid off the bus.
Its nice to see how this situation was handled, from top to bottom, and nice to see that it appeared to be resolved between the two youngsters. _________________ www.haysgym.com
